Virginia man busted for DWI in Nassau

NASSAU, NY — Nassau Village Police on Friday arrested a 54-year-old Virginia man for allegedly driving while intoxicating on Church Street in the village.

Police say, Bruce Chinault, of Sanston, VA, crossed the roadway’s double yellow line. After a traffic stop, it was discovered that the man’s blood alcohol content (BAC) was 0.13 percent – 0.05 percentage points over the state’s legal limit of 0.08.

Chinault was processed and released on $200 police bail with traffic tickets to appear in Nassau Village Court on Nov. 14 at 6:30 p.m.
